American politics : ideals and realities / George McKenna

By: McKenna, George [author]Material type: TextTextPublication details: New York : McGraw-Hill Book Company, c1976Description: xiv, 335 pages ; 24 cmISBN: 0070453551Subject(s): UNITED STATES -- POLITICS AND GOVERNMENT -- HANDBOOKS, MANUALS, ETC | POLITICAL PARTICIPATION -- UNITED STATESLOC classification: JK 274 .M35 1976
Contents:
Part One. Prerequisites for democracy -- Part Two. Processes of democracy -- Part Three. Components of american democracy.
Summary: This book is an attempt to analyze American political institutions and processes from the standpoint of the old liberal ideas, which, I am convinced, can provide a more realistic framework for analysis than much of what has passed for realism over the past century.
